Damaged Nissan interiors in Castlereagh
Vehicle interiors can also be damaged, such as fabric tears, chipped vinyl and scuffed surfaces. Interior surfaces and seats made from leather can get torn, but experienced Castlereagh garage specialists are able to carry out restorations.
Plain or patterned velour seat covers can have restoration work carried out on them, whether there are holes from cigarette burns, or tears and rips need repairing. Trim and dashboards made from vinyl can suffer from scratches of various depths, and surface scuffs, whilst mobile phone holders can leave behind holes when removed, which are not very attractive.
However they can be filled in and painted to match manufacturer's original colouring and textures.

Lexus rear bumper repairs in Castlereagh
Bumpers are found at the back and front of every car therefore bumpers are the primary place on a vehicle to be hit and damaged in a collision with other road users or obstacles such as bollards or barriers. Minor damage can occur, like dings or dents, paint scuffs on co-ordinated bumpers or scratches.
Higher levels of damage can be caused in larger impacts, like cracking or splitting your bumper. Reputable garages in Castlereagh can offer services for quality body work repairs such as bumper replacement when they are beyond repair, or for small areas, painting filled areas and re-texturing where necessary.
Restoring Castlereagh alloy wheels
Many people like the finishing touch alloy wheels add to a vehicle, whether your car make is a Seat or a Honda model vehicle. Different rim depth and spoke arrangements are on offer when choosing alloy wheels, as well as different colours and sizes, from 15" to 19" versions.
Alloy damage does unfortunately occur, usually from accidents or from exposure to the elements. Corrosion caused by salt content in road grit frequently occurs, whilst bubbling in the edge of the metal can ruin the effect your alloy wheels create.
Dents and kerbing marks can also spoil alloys whilst you're parking your car, whilst scratches and scuffs can affect the texture. Castlereagh alloy restoration services can be provided to repair wheels using filling, painting and lacquering to provide complete refurbishment of alloys that make your tyres look great.
